超强台风 Ragasa 远海近岸异常加强的特征和原因分析

Characteristics and causes of the anomalous intensification of super typhoon Ragasa over offshore and nearshore regions

  • 摘要: 超强台风桦加沙(Ragasa)经历了远海快速加强(RI)、近岸强台风维持(Near-LF)的强度异常变化。本文重点剖析其相关的内核结构特征及台风加强指数(TCII)演变,揭示强度异常变化的原因。剖析台风强度异常相关的涡旋几何特性、内核热动力和外部环境特征,发现相对于Pre-RI时期,台风RI、Near-LF阶段具备水平尺度显著收缩、垂直方向涡旋趋于直立、非对称性减小、低层相对涡度和相当位温径向梯度增强、罗斯贝数Ro 增长特性;但登陆前Near-LF阶段非对称性增大。采用吸纳了上述指示性特征要素、可综合表征台风异常变化的指标(Y 指数、罗斯贝数Ro、台风加强指数TCII),计算表明TCII可较好指示RI和Near-LF阶段的强度异常变化,Y 指数增长是 TCII 升高、RI启动/ Near-LF强台风维持的主导因子;登陆前非对称性增强导致 Y的贡献度降低,台风尺度和旋转动能变化的贡献占比大为提高。进一步开展切变相对坐标系的通风效应、中层增湿、动量收支分析,揭示台风强度异常变化的原因。发现顺切变(DS)及其左侧(LS)的台风加强优势象限,RI 之前DS象限的低层正通风(即暖湿异常入流)、RI期间DS象限的中层增湿特征显著;Near-LF 阶段 LS 象限的低层正通风及中层增湿是近岸强台风维持的重要原因。RI 期间切向风加速主要由平均径向涡度通量驱动,径向风则是在梯度风平衡约束下重新调整;而登陆前阶段动量收支过程表现为强内核的维持与再分配;二者共同构建了桦加沙远海快速加强及近岸强台风维持的内部动力调整机制。

     

    Abstract: Super Typhoon Ragasa experienced anomalous intensity changes, characterized by offshore rapid intensification (RI) and nearshore intense typhoon maintenance (Near LF). This study focuses on analyzing the associated inner core structural characteristics and the evolution of the typhoon intensification index (TCII) to reveal the causes of these anomalous intensity changes. By examining the vortex geometric properties, inner core thermodynamic and dynamic features, and external environmental conditions related to the intensity anomalies, we find that, compared with the Pre RI period, the RI and Near LF stages are characterized by a significant contraction in horizontal scale, a more upright vertical vortex structure, reduced asymmetry, enhanced low level relative vorticity and radial gradient of equivalent potential temperature, and increased Rossby number Ro. However, during the pre landfall Near LF stage, the asymmetry increases. Using composite indices that incorporate these indicative factors and can comprehensively represent typhoon anomalies—namely the Y index, Rossby number Ro, and typhoon intensification index TCII—our calculations show that TCII effectively captures the intensity anomalies during both the RI and near LF stages. The increase in the Y index is the dominant factor driving the rise in TCII and the onset of RI / maintenance of the intense typhoon during near LF. As asymmetry intensifies before landfall, the contribution of the Y index decreases, while the contributions of changes in typhoon size and rotational kinetic energy become substantially more important. Further analyses of ventilation effects in a shear relative coordinate system, mid level moistening, and momentum budgets are conducted to reveal the physical causes of the intensity anomalies. The down shear (DS) and left of shear (LS) quadrants are identified as the preferential sectors for intensification. Before RI, notable positive low level ventilation (warm and moist anomalous inflow) occurs in the DS quadrant, and during RI, mid level moistening is also evident in the DS quadrant. During the Near LF stage, positive low level ventilation and mid level moistening in the LS quadrant play key roles on sustaining the nearshore intense typhoon. During the RI period, the tangential wind acceleration is primarily driven by the mean radial vorticity flux, while the radial wind adjusts under gradient wind balance constraints. Before landfall, the momentum budget processes manifest as maintenance and redistribution of the strong inner core. Together, these processes constitute the internal dynamic adjustment mechanisms responsible for Ragasa''s offshore rapid intensification and nearshore maintenance.
